And it came to pass after these things that God tempted Abraam, and said to him, Abraam, Abraam; and he said, Lo! I am here.
Καὶ ἐγένετο μετὰ τὰ ῥήματα ταῦτα ὁ Θεὸς ἐπείρασε τὸν Ἁβραὰμ, καὶ εἶπεν αὐτῷ, Ἁβραὰμ, Ἁβραάμ· καὶ εἶπεν, ἰδοὺ ἐγώ.
And he said, Take thy son, the beloved one, whom thou hast loved—Isaac, and go into the high land, and offer him there for a whole-burnt-offering on one of the mountains which I will tell thee of.
Καὶ εἶπε, λάβε τὸν υἱόν σου τὸν ἀγαπητὸν, ὃν ἠγάπησας, τὸν Ἰσαὰκ, καὶ πορεύθητι εἰς τὴν γῆν τὴν ὑψηλὴν, καὶ ἀνένεγκε αὐτὸν ἐκεῖ εἰς ὁλοκάρπωσιν ἐφʼ ἓν τῶν ὀρέων ὧν ἄν σοι εἴπω.
And Abraam rose up in the morning and saddled his ass, and he took with him two servants, and Isaac his son, and having split wood for a whole-burnt-offering, he arose and departed, and came to the place of which God spoke to him,
Ἀναστὰς δὲ Ἁβραὰμ τὸ πρωῒ, ἐπέσαξε τὴν ὄνον αὐτοῦ· παρέλαβε δὲ μεθʼ ἑαυτοῦ δύο παῖδας, καὶ Ἰσαὰκ τὸν υἱὸν αὐτοῦ· καὶ σχίσας ξύλα εἰς ὁλοκάρπωσιν, ἀναστὰς ἐπορεύθη, καὶ ἦλθεν ἐπὶ τὸν τόπον, ὃν εἶπεν αὐτῷ ὁ Θεὸς, τῇ ἡμέρᾳ τῇ τρίτῃ.
on the third day; and Abraam having lifted up his eyes, saw the place afar off.
Καὶ ἀναβλέψας Ἁβραὰμ τοῖς ὀφθαλμοῖς αὐτοῦ, εἶδε τὸν τόπον μακρόθεν.
And Abraam said to his servants, Sit ye here with the ass, and I and the lad will proceed thus far, and having worshipped we will return to you.
Καὶ εἶπεν Ἁβραὰμ τοῖς παισὶν αὐτοῦ, καθίσατε αὐτοῦ μετὰ τῆς ὄνου· ἐγὼ δὲ καὶ τὸ παιδάριον διελευσόμεθα ἕως ὧδε· καὶ προσκυνήσαντες ἀναστρέψομεν πρὸς ὑμᾶς.
And Abraam took the wood of the whole-burnt-offering, and laid it on Isaac his son, and he took into his hands both the fire and the knife, and the two went together.
Ἔλαβε δὲ Ἁβραὰμ τὰ ξύλα τῆς ὁλοκαρπώσεως, καὶ ἐπέθηκεν Ἰσαὰκ τῷ υἱῷ αὐτοῦ· ἔλαβε δὲ μετὰ χεῖρας καὶ τὸ πῦρ καὶ τὴν μάχαιραν, καὶ ἐπορεύθησαν οἱ δύο ἅμα.
And Isaac said to Abraam his father, Father. And he said, What is it, son? And he said, Behold the fire and the wood, where is the sheep for a whole-burnt-offering?
Εἶπε δὲ Ἰσαὰκ πρὸς Ἁβραὰμ τὸν πατέρα αὐτοῦ, πάτερ· ὁ δὲ εἶπε, τί ἐστι, τέκνον; εἶπε, δὲ, ἰδοὺ τὸ πῦρ καὶ τὰ ξύλα, ποῦ ἐστὶ τὸ πρόβατον τὸ εἰς ὁλοκάρπωσιν;
And Abraam said, God will provide himself a sheep for a whole-burnt-offering, my son. And both having gone together,
Εἶπε δὲ Ἁβραὰμ, ὁ Θεὸς ὄψεται ἑαυτῷ πρόβατον εἰς ὁλοκάρπωσιν, τέκνον. πορευθέντες δὲ ἀμφότεροι ἅμα,
came to the place which God spoke of to him; and there Abraam built the altar, and laid the wood on it, and having bound the feet of Isaac his son together, he laid him on the altar upon the wood.
ἦλθον ἐπὶ τὸν τόπον, ὃν εἶπεν αὐτῷ ὁ Θεός· καὶ ᾠκοδόμησεν ἐκεῖ Ἁβραὰμ τὸ θυσιαστήριον, καὶ ἐπέθηκε τὰ ξύλα· καὶ συμποδίσας Ἰσαὰκ τὸν υἱὸν αὐτοῦ, ἐπέθηκεν αὐτὸν ἐπὶ τὸ θυσιαστήριον ἐπάνω τῶν ξύλων.
And Abraam stretched forth his hand to take the knife to slay his son.
Καὶ ἐξέτεινεν Ἁβραὰμ τὴν χεῖρα αὐτοῦ λαβεῖν τὴν μάχαιραν, σφάξαι τὸν υἱὸν αὐτοῦ.
And an angel of the Lord called him out of heaven, and said, Abraam, Abraam. And he said, Behold, I am here.
Καὶ ἐκάλεσεν αὐτὸν Ἄγγελος Κυρίου ἐκ τοῦ οὐρανοῦ, καὶ εἶπεν, Ἁβραὰμ, Ἁβραάμ· ὁ δὲ εἶπεν, ἰδοὺ ἐγώ.
And he said, Lay not thine hand upon the child, neither do anything to him, for now I know that thou fearest God, and for my sake thou hast not spared thy beloved son.
Καὶ εἶπε, μὴ ἐπιβάλῃς τὴν χεῖρά σου ἐπὶ τὸ παιδάριον, μηδὲ ποιήσῃς αὐτῷ μηδέν· νῦν γὰρ ἔγνων, ὅτι φοβῇ σὺ τὸν Θεόν· καὶ οὐκ ἐφείσω τοῦ υἱοῦ σου τοῦ ἀγαπητοῦ διʼ ἐμέ.
And Abraam lifted up his eyes and beheld, and lo! a ram caught by his horns in a plant of Sabec; and Abraam went and took the ram, and offered him up for a whole-burnt-offering in the place of Isaac his son.
Καὶ ἀναβλέψας Ἁβραὰμ τοῖς ὀφθαλμοῖς αὐτοῦ εἶδε, καὶ ἰδοὺ κριὸς εἷς κατεχόμενος ἐν φυτῷ Σαβὲκ τῶν κεράτων. Καὶ ἐπορεύθη Ἁβραὰμ, καὶ ἔλαβε τὸν κριὸν, καὶ ἁνήνεγκεν αὐτὸν εἰς ὁλοκάρπωσιν ἀντὶ Ἰσαὰκ τοῦ υἱοῦ αὐτοῦ.
And Abraam called the name of that place, The Lord hath seen; that they might say to-day, In the mount the Lord was seen.
Καὶ ἐκάλεσεν Ἁβραὰμ τὸ ὄνομα τοῦ τόπου ἐκείνου, Κύριος εἶδεν· ἵνα εἴπωσιν σήμερον, ἐν τῷ ὄρει Κύριος ὤφθη.
And an angel of the Lord called Abraam the second time out of heaven,
Καὶ ἐκάλεσεν Ἄγγελος Κυρίου τὸν Ἁβραὰμ δεύτερον ἐκ τοῦ οὐρανοῦ,
saying, I have sworn by myself, says the Lord, because thou hast done this thing, and on my account hast not spared thy beloved son,
λέγων, Κατʼ ἐμαυτοῦ ὤμοσα, λέγει Κύριος, οὗ εἵνεκεν ἐποίησας τὸ ῥῆμα τοῦτο, καὶ οὐκ ἐφείσω τοῦ υἱοῦ σου τοῦ ἀγαπτοῦ διʼ ἐμὲ,
surely blessing I will bless thee, and multiplying I will multiply thy seed as the stars of heaven, and as the sand which is by the shore of the sea, and thy seed shall inherit the cities of their enemies.
Ἦ μὴν εὐλογῶν εὐλογήσω σε, καὶ πληθύνων πληθυνῶ τὸ σπέρμα σου, ὡς τοὺς ἀστέρας τοῦ οὐρανοῦ, καὶ ὡς τὴν ἄμμον τὴν παρὰ τὸ χεῖλος τῆς θαλάσσης· καὶ κληρονομήσει τὸ σπέρμα σου τὰς πόλεις τῶν ὑπεναντίων.
And in thy seed shall all the nations of the earth be blessed, because thou hast hearkened to my voice.
Καὶ ἐνευλογηθήσονται ἐν τῷ σπέρματί σου πάντα τὰ ἔθνη τῆς γῆς, ἀνθʼ ὧν ὑπήκουσας τῆς ἐμῆς φωνῆς.
And Abraam returned to his servants, and they arose and went together to the well of the oath; and Abraam dwelt at the well of the oath.
Ἀπεστράφη δὲ Ἁβραὰμ πρὸς τοὺς παῖδας αὐτοῦ· καὶ ἀναστάντες ἐπορεύθησαν ἅμα ἐπὶ τὸ φρέαρ τοῦ ὅρκου. Καὶ κατῴκησεν Ἁβραὰμ ἐπὶ τὸ φρέαρ τοῦ ὅρκου.
And it came to pass after these things, that it was reported to Abraam, saying, Behold, Melcha herself too has born sons to Nachor thy brother,
Ἐγένετο δὲ μετὰ τὰ ῥήματα ταῦτα, καὶ ἀνηγγέλη τῷ Ἁβραὰμ, λέγοντες, ἰδοὺ τέτοκε Μελχὰ καὶ αὐτὴ υἱοὺς τῷ Ναχὼρ τῷ ἀδελφῷ σου,
Uz the first-born, and Baux his brother, and Camuel the father of the Syrians, and Chazad, and
τὸν Οὒζ πρωτότοκον, καὶ τὸν Βαὺξ ἀδελφὸν αὐτοῦ, καὶ τὸν Καμουὴλ πατέρα Σύρων,
Azav and Phaldes, and Jeldaph, and Bathuel, and Bathuel begot Rebecca;
καὶ τὸν Χαζὰδ, καὶ Ἀζαῦ, καὶ τὸν Φαλδὲς, καὶ τὸν Ἰελδὰφ, καὶ τὸν Βαθουήλ.
these are eight sons, which Melcha bore to Nachor the brother of Abraam.
Βαθουὴλ δὲ ἐγέννησε τὴν Ῥεβέκκαν. ὀκτὼ οὗτοι υἱοὶ, οὓς ἔτεκε Μελχὰ τῷ Ναχὼρ τῷ ἀδελφῷ Ἁβραάμ.
And his concubine whose name was Rheuma, she also bore Tabec, and Taam, and Tochos, and Mocha.
Καὶ ἡ παλλακὴ αὐτοῦ, ᾗ ὄνομα Ῥεύμα, ἔτεκε καὶ αὐτὴ τὸν Ταβὲκ, καὶ τὸν Ταὰμ, καὶ τὸν Τοχός, καὶ τὸν Μοχά.
